Product reviews:
Les
2025-10-08 iphone 11 Pro
Joey Kangaroo Plush Stuffed Animal kangaroo stuffed animal walmart
kangaroo stuffed animal walmart
Todd
2025-10-02 iphone 6s Plus
Large Eyes Giraffe Plush Stuffed Animal kangaroo stuffed animal walmart
kangaroo stuffed animal walmart
Steven
2025-10-02 iphone 7 Plus
Soft Toys Plush Stuffed Animal kangaroo stuffed animal walmart
kangaroo stuffed animal walmart